Marketing and Business Development Coordinator
Greenberg Traurig (GT) is a global law firm with an exciting employment opportunity for a Marketing and Business Development Coordinator in their San Francisco office. The role involves working closely with the Marketing and Business Development Manager to develop and implement marketing initiatives, prepare business development materials, and assist in organizing events, all while collaborating with various teams within the firm.

Responsibilities
Work closely with the Marketing and Business Development Manager to develop and implement the marketing and business development initiatives for the Northern California offices
Understands the local practices, office initiatives, and representations of key clients
Prepares business development materials, including drafting pitches, collaborating with attorneys on proposals and drafting, managing and submitting responses to Requests for Proposals (RFPs), and producing other collateral materials. This includes conducting, requesting and analyzing research, preparing pitches, proposals, presentations and other client-facing documents, utilizing existing content and, when needed, writing new content, and ensuring delivery and/or production requirements are met
Drafts, edits and distributes marketing materials, internal newsletters, press releases, seminar materials, invitations, client updates, and other client communications, as needed
Assists in the deployment of programs and events hosted/sponsored by the firm, such as teleconferences, webinars, seminars, and other events, including the development and production of marketing materials and on-site logistics. Assist in coordinating and executing attorney participation in marketing profile-raising events
Maintains office and practice specific content and compile information and draft submissions for directory and ranking authorities such as Chambers USA, Legal 500, IFLR, American Bar Association, Law360, US News/Best Lawyers, etc
Creates and maintains records of the firm’s specific practice experience, utilizing the firm’s experience database
Develops relationships with attorneys to serve as point of contact for day-to-day requests and marketing and business development needs
Organizes regularly-scheduled practice group conference calls, as well as initiate following-up on specific action items arising from those discussions
Ensures the flow of information from attorneys to marketing team, including as it relates to attorney biographies, practice area description updates, experience tracking news and activities data, press releases, new team members, etc
Collaborates with marketing professionals throughout the firm, including the communications team, marketing research team, RFP team, events team, and creative teams across a number of functions on an as-needed basis
Works with marketing research team to gather research and analysis on targets, industries, and judges, as needed for business development purposes
Maintains mailing lists, spreadsheet creation and tracking and other administrative duties as assigned
Provides back-up services to the marketing department on an as-needed basis
Assists with and manage a variety of short and long-term projects and day to day requests
Collaborates with marketing and other business professionals throughout the firm across functions and teams

Greenberg Traurig, LLP
Greenberg Traurig, LLP has more than 3,000 attorneys across 51 locations in the United States, Europe, the Middle East, Latin America, and Asia.
